- 1 NAME
- 2 CORE METADATA FIELDS
- 3 REFERENCES AND RELATED OBJECTS
- 4 METHODS
- 5 SEE ALSO
- 6 COPYRIGHT
EPrints::DataObj::Request - Log document requests and responses (for request document button).
CORE METADATA FIELDS
The unique identifier for this request
The ID for any document this request may relate.
The datestamp this request was created.
The email address to which this request is sent.
The email address of the requester.
The reason the request was made.
The time at which this request will expires.
The code for this request, which can be used to created private URLS.
The ReCAPTCHA field for the form for this request.
REFERENCES AND RELATED OBJECTS
The ID of the eprint data object associated with this request.
The ID of the user to whom this request is assigned.
$fields = EPrints::DataObj::Request->get_system_field_info
Returns an array describing the system metadata of the request dataset.
$dataset = EPrints::DataObj::Request->get_dataset_id
Returns the ID of the EPrints::DataSet object to which this record belongs.
$request = EPrints::DataObj::Request->new_from_code( $session, $code )
Returns request that matches provided $code.
$boolean = $request->has_required( $session, $code )
Returns a boolean depending on whether the request with $code has expired yet.
© Copyright 2022 University of Southampton.
EPrints 3.4 is supplied by EPrints Services.
This file is part of EPrints 3.4 http://www.eprints.org/.
EPrints 3.4 and this file are released under the terms of the GNU Lesser General Public License version 3 as published by the Free Software Foundation unless otherwise stated.
EPrints 3.4 is distributed in the hope that it will be useful, but WITHOUT 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the GNU Lesser General Public License for more details.
You should have received a copy of the GNU Lesser General Public License along with EPrints 3.4. If not, see http://www.gnu.org/licenses/.